Born in Lancaster, SC, she was the daughter of the late L.C. and Sarah Gunn Polston.
Anita was a very loving mother and daughter who enjoyed spending time outdoors with her family and her animals. She had a very giving heart and would do anything for anyone. All that knew her will miss her.
In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her grandson, Colton and her only sister, Angie.
She is survived by her children, Brandon, Breanna, Brittany and her husband, Mark, Kay, and Tra; grandson, Jay. Anita is also survived by numerous other children that she loved as her own.
A visitation with the family will be held on Friday, April 16, 2021 from 10-11am at A Simple Service Burial and Cremation. A graveside service will follow the visitation in Lancaster Memorial Park.
